Details:

Returning to the multiple point-of-view structure that made his debut novel  Party so remarkable, author Tom Leveen spins a story of several high school students on the brink, and a school that can't (or won't) see the daily stressors they endure...or grasp the potential consequences of that dismissal. Danny can't get a fair shake from teachers or his parents, or even Cadence, the wide-eyed bundle of energy he's falling in love with. Brady pretends to want to be an NFL quarterback, but really just needs a square meal and a roof over his head. Drea knows only one way to make the pain of neglect go away; Vivi feels under siege by girls who don't like  her type; and football star Donte has to quell his affection for the one girl in the entire school he absolutely cannot have while trying to protect Brady from Brady's own worst impulses.  That's just the first day.  Mercy Rule follows this diverse cast of authentically drawn teens as they ask the question somehow unique to modern American culture: Can you see me?  Do you see me?  Will you see me?  Because if you won't . . . I'll make you.

From the Inside Flap Danny's parents yanked him from the art school that let him wear a kilt and listen to bands that no one's heard of. Now he's starting sophomore year at the public high school--the one with the gymnasium at the heart of the building and the glorified athletes who rule it all. The smart thing would be to blend in, but Danny has always been about making  statements. Brady just wants to get out. Go to college, play football, maybe reach the NFL. He definitely wants to stop waiting for his deadbeat mother to come home, sleeping on park benches, and going to bed hungry. But first he has to lead the team to the championships. It all adds up to a lot of stress. So who can really blame him when he and the football team turn their aggressions on the new freak? Even the quarterback needs to blow off steam sometimes. Coach turns a blind eye to his players' crimes--because this year, they're going to State. But maybe if Coach had paid more attention they could've caught it before it all happened. Maybe it could've been avoided. Maybe. With quick cuts between a large cast of unforgettable characters, and razor-sharp plotting, Tom Leveen takes readers on a countdown to an inevitable, horrifying act. This gripping novel offers an intense, smart perspective on the tragic, toxic mindsets behind the celebrated American sport and the monsters it creates.

About the Author:

Tom Leveen is an award-winning author of nine novels, including Zero, an ALA Best Fiction for Young Adults 2013; Sick, a YALSA Quick Pick 2014, Westerchester award winner and Grand Canyon Reader Award winner; and Hellworld, a Stoker Award nominee. A rocking and frequent speaker at schools and conferences, Tom lives and writes full-time in Phoenix, Arizona....
